Which type of climate is experienced in the Northern Plains of India? State one main characteristic of this type of climate.

उत्तर
The northern plains experiences ‘continental’ type of climate as it is far away from the oceanic effect. The main characteristics of this type of climate is, that it experiences extremes of temperature in the months of summer and winter i.e. it is extremely hot in summer and extremely cold in winter.
